Benin - Construction Value Added

Since 2014, Benin Construction Value Added jumped by 1.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 129 among other countries in Construction Value Added with $684,395,100.58. Benin is overtaken by Syria, which was ranked number 128 with $703,161,935.81 and is followed by Bosnia and Herzegovina at $675,528,015.05. China topped the ranking with $869,796,879,863.04 in 2019, +4.3% versus 2018. United States, Japan and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ethiopia witnessed the best average annual growth at +21.7% per year, while Libya was the worst growing country at -34.7% per year.
